- The distance between Scuro Mountain, Italy and Alpena, Michigan, Usa is approximately 7,701 km or 4,786 mi.
- To reach Scuro Mountain in this distance one would set out from Alpena, Michigan bearing 54.6°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Scuro Mountain bearing 131.9° or SE .
- Scuro Mountain has a Mediterranean warm climate (Csb) whereas Alpena, Michigan has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Scuro Mountain is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ome whereas Alpena, Michigan is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 1.3 °C (2.4°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 11.8 °C (21.2°F) less in Scuro Mountain.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 78 mm (3.1 in) more which is equivalent to 78 l/m² (1.91 US gal/ft²) or 780,000 l/ha (83,387 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 5.8° higher in Scuro Mountain than in Alpena, Michigan.
- Relative humidity levels are 14.5%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 4°C (7.1°F) higher.
